Term:hexacarbonylchromium
go back to main search page
Accession:CHEBI:33031 term browser browse the term
Definition:An organochromium compound that has formula C6CrO6.
Synonyms:exact_synonym: hexacarbonylchromium(0)
 related_synonym: Cr(CO)6;   Formula=C6CrO6;   InChI=1S/6CO.Cr/c6*1-2;;   InChIKey=KOTQLLUQLXWWDK-UHFFFAOYSA-N;   SMILES=[O]#C[Cr](C#[O])(C#[O])(C#[O])(C#[O])C#[O];   chromium hexacarbonyl
 xref: CAS:13007-92-6;   Gmelin:3976;   MolBase:56
